wonder if you can still order those side number panels? Are those built for the Uly, or some leftover lightening parts where you had to drill holes to get them to fit the Uly??
Top of pagePrevious messageNext messageBottom of page Link to this message

Froggy
Posted on Monday, November 19, 2012 - 03:42 pm:   Edit Post Delete Post View Post/Check IP Print Post    Move Post (Custodian/Admin Only) Ban Poster IP (Custodian/Admin only)

Those side panels are still available and came stock on the XB12STT. The mounting holes do not exist on the stock Ulysses seatrails, so you will have to improvise.
